NOTICE OF APPOINTMENT OF RECEIVERS
ASCOT CONSTRUCTION CO. LTD.
(PURSUANT TO THE COMPANIES ACT 1955, SECTION 346 (1))

ON 23 April 1982, John Burns and Co. Ltd, and United Concrete Ltd, appointed as receivers and managers of all the property of Ascot Construction Co. Ltd., Anthony Walpole Bowden and Neil Graham Impey, both of Auckland, chartered accountants, whose address is care of Bowden, Impey and Sage, Parnell House, 430 Parnell Road, Auckland.

The appointment was made pursuant to powers contained and implied by law in a debenture dated 11 August 1980 and issued to them by Ascot Construction Co. Ltd.

The property in respect of which the receivers and managers have been appointed comprises all the undertaking, goodwill and assets and all the real and personal property whatsoever and wheresoever situate, both present and future, and includes the company’s unpaid calls and uncalled capital for the time being and all its stock-in-trade, plant, machinery, implements, fixtures, fittings, shares, book debts and furniture.

J. R. FLAWS, Solicitor for the Debenture Holder.
